the University of Padua (Italy) and the University of St. Andrews (United Kingdom) are pleased to invite you to their Joint Virtual International Staff Training Week, which will be held on June 7th – 10th 2021.
This year’s Training Week is dedicated to Celebrating University Anniversaries and builds on the upcoming 800th anniversary celebrations of the University of Padua in 2022 and on the 600th anniversary celebrations at St. Andrews in 2013. We will discuss both academic and general topics, from collections and cultural heritage, to communication and global engagement, logistics, fundraising and alumni, not to forget the legacy of these celebrations.
The event represents a unique opportunity to learn, benchmark and network with colleagues from across the globe and is aimed at supporting institutions in making the most out of their anniversary celebrations.
The Staff Training Week is open to all academic and administrative staff members of our partner and prospective partner universities. The event is free of charge.

It is our pleasure to invite you to The On-line International Week: Teaching and Staff Training: New European Trends in Psychology and Educational Sciences, organize by The Erasmus Department of the Faculty of Psychology and Educational Sciences, together with the Centre for International Cooperation at Babes-Bolyai University, Romania, which will take place between 19 and 23 of April 2021.
Our on-line event aims to bring together staff from partner institutions to strengthen international networks, exchange good practice and develop personal and professional skills relating to cutting edge topics in student support, in the field of Psychology and Educational Sciences.
International Week will have two main components: (1) Teaching and (2) Staff Training.
- Teaching: You can teach online to the students from Babes-Bolyai University, topics on your expertise field
- Staff Training: You can participate at several webinars in the field of Psychology or Educational Sciences

We are turning to you with a kind request to fill in an online survey on support needs of mobile academic staff conducted by the international EU-funded Erasmus+ project called UniWeliS aimed at supporting internationalisation of higher education through professionalising services for mobile academic staff.
The aim of the survey is to collect evidence and data on mobility experiences and support needs of international researchers, lecturers and PhD students in the Central-Eastern and South-Eastern European countries. Based on this study we will design practical tools that will facilitate the successful integration of international academics in these countries. The created tools will be of a great benefit to future mobile academics and contribute to the continued improvement of academic staff mobility opportunities and services in the target region. Typically, we are aiming at a mobility experience longer than three months and carried out within past five years.

We cordially invite you to our international workshop ECMSM that will take place at Liberec on 2021-06-21 to 2021-06-22, https://www.ecmsm.eu/ecmsm2021/.
The IEEE International Workshop of Electronics, Control, Measurement, Signals and their application to Mechatronics provides an international forum for the exchange of ideas, discussions on research results and the presentation of theoretical and practical applications in several areas of mechatronics. It has been established on the close long-lasting cooperation between Technical University of Liberec (TUL) and University Paul Sabatier (UPS) from France and is organised every second year.
We would be thrilled to have you present at this workshop and to hear from you about a few new technology advancements and their impact on different business markets and daily lives.
The workshop will be held on a hybrid mode: onsite and online attendance options are available.
The abstract submission deadline is just two weeks away. Don’t miss the opportunity to join this international workshop and submit your abstract before the 2021 February 22th for consideration for oral or virtual presentation.
The accepted papers are published in IEEE CSDL and indexed by SCOPUS and WoS.

STUDENTS WITH SPECIAL NEEDS
J. Selye University believes that every student can go abroad to learn different languages, get to know other cultures and increase his/her knowledge.
The aim of the service is to help students with special needs (dyslexia, dysgraphia, dyscalculia, reduced mobility, visual impairment, hearing impairment… etc.).
Students with special needs may apply for specific support after they have been selected for an Erasmus mobility period. Once a student has been accepted for a course of study, the University tries ensure appropriate provision for that student throughout his/her course. Students with disabilities can expect to be integrated into the normal University environment. They are encouraged and helped to be responsible for their own learning and so achieve their full academic potential.
